What is 'LJ' mean in Chinese Slang?
LJ stands for '垃圾' (lā jī), used to describe things of poor quality or no value. This term is particularly common in online games, where players often use it to evaluate equipment or skills. Although it carries negative connotations, it can also be used to express humor or self-deprecation in specific contexts.
Example: When criticizing poor quality, you might say 'This product is LJ.'
Warning: Can be offensive when used to describe people.
